Central road cleaning works are going on intensively in all directions
16 January, 2022 16:58:40

"During the last 24 hours, unusually heavy rain fell throughout Georgia, which created some problems on the central roads under the management of the Roads Department. Relevant cleaning works were carried out in all directions for 24 hours, the roads were treated with technical salt. Restrictions were imposed only on trailers and semi-trailers. At this point, we can say that movement on the central highways in all directions is free for all types of vehicles. We again call on the people of Georgia and our citizens to obey the relevant restrictions and drive with the appropriate winter tires in order to move safely on the highways, "said Giorgi Tsereteli, Chairman of the Roads Department, while inspecting the ongoing cleaning works on the Gori road.

Due to the difficult meteorological conditions, in order to avoid traffic jams on the roads, the cleaning works continue continuously throughout Georgia. The works are carried out by the Roads Department of the Ministry of Regional Development and Infrastructure of Georgia. Snow-clearing equipment is mobilized in all directions, the roads are constantly treated with sand-salt mixture.

As a result of intensive cleaning works, at the moment, traffic is free on Tbilisi-Senaki-Leselidze, Akhaltsikhe-Ninotsminda, Akhalkalaki-Kartsakhi and Khashuri-Akhaltsikhe-Vale roads.

Also at this time, the mode of movement of anti-skid chains on the Sachkhere-Oni road and Nakerala Pass has been lifted, while restrictions on the movement of trailers and semi-trailers are still in force.
